The Red Rose 50 is consistent with its dates which is the middle of September so quite rightly they have picked 14/15th Sept. The Shotley 50 two years ago was on the first weekend of September, but and a very important but, a section of the walk is governed by the tides. I believe this is the reason for picking the 14/15th.

I completely agree , it is very frustrating & the clash of dates seems to happen every year around Easter & Sept . On 14/9 there are four events I would like to enter (Shotley gets the vote as I want to complete the Eastern TC) & on 21/9 there are FIVE events I would do if it were possible (Sussex Stride gets the vote to keep the sequence going on the Southern TC) .

On 06/07 April there are EIGHT events out of which I would consider five (Woldsman bags the entry!) with a further six to choose from the weekend after ... then nothing as usual on the Easter w/end .

On the one hand it’s fantastic to have so much choice but equally frustrating when there are missed events thru annual date clashes inevitably bookended by a quiet weekend or two . The choice of date could, in some cases, be determined by availability of Event HQ/CPs/organisers etc but it seems a shame not to try & better coordinate events across the LDWA nationally when nearly all take place annually with their customary place in the calendar .

Has anyone else noticed?

7/8th Sept No LDWA organised events
14/15 Sept Three LDWA organised events including two fifties.
21/22nd Sep Six LDWA organised events including two fifties.
28/29th Sept No LDWA organised events.

I'm sure all the event organizers have good reasons for choosing these dates, but as an events junkie I'm frustrated as I cannot be in two places at the same time.
